March is maple sugaring time - head on up to Up Yonda Farm in Bolton Landing - they'll take you through all the steps from sap to syrup.  Make plans to join Up Yonda on Sunday from 9am to 2pm for the Pancake Breakfast and Maple Festival - $7.00 per person.  For more information and reservation forms, please visit upyondafarm.com

Mary Giella designed, owns and operates Lumberjack Pass Miniature Golf and Fore! Ice Cream, Burgers and More in Lake George. Mary was first introduced to Lake George in 1977 while on her honeymoon. It was her goal to one day be a full time resident of this beautiful Lake George region and, in 2001, she realized her dream with the opening of Lumberjack Pass Mini Golf. In the years since her opening. Mary has expanded the mini golf course to include a soft serve ice cream shop and lite fare foods for the entire family.
